Deciphering the Multi-Level Progressive Jackpot System

Traditional progressive jackpots link players across multiple machines or platforms, dynamically increasing the prize pool until a fortunate player claims the top prize. However, newer implementations introduce layered structures that group jackpots into different levels—each with its own criteria, payout potential, and excitement curve. These systems set the stage for diversified gameplay, where players can trigger, progress, and ultimately win across multiple tiers of jackpots.

For instance, consider a slot game embedded with a Progressive feature with 4 levels — each level representing a distinct jackpot that is unlocked through specific in-game actions, such as completing bonus rounds or achieving certain symbol combinations. This layered approach encourages continuous play, as players seek to ascend through the levels for bigger rewards.

Design Considerations and Player Psychology

The psychology behind multi-level progressive features hinges on *perceived control* and the *hope for bigger wins.* When players see a clear pathway—say, from Level 1 to Level 4—they are incentivised to continue spinning, especially if there are actionable milestones, such as mini-bonuses or free spins unlocked at each stage. The visual cues, sound effects, and countdown timers associated with each level further reinforce this motivation.

Developers must balance the probability of jackpot wins at each level to maintain fairness while ensuring the jackpots remain compelling enough to hold the player’s interest. Transparency about the odds, combined with an engaging reward structure, enhances trust and long-term loyalty.
